Team Overview

The Rotational Development Program (RDP) provides a combination of rotational assignments, mentoring, and coaching to build a broad range of experience across business areas critical to Edward Jones. Rotation Programs are a springboard for early career talent to gain experiences, knowledge, and networks that will accelerate their contributions and impact to Edward Jones.

What You'll Do

This is a fourteen-month program is designed to provide an opportunity for RDP associates to enhance their career and develop business competencies by working collaboratively with program peers and leaders while contributing to key assignments.

They rotate through different roles within their assigned division as well as complete one rotation outside of their assigned division. Along with on-the-job experiences, every rotation has learning and development opportunities.

The Three Main Objectives Are

  • Deliver on outcomes identified within the assigned project.
  • Connect the work and share ideas across other areas.
  • Identify and focus on professional development.

Program Inclusions

  • Paid full-time study to obtain SIE, and Series 7 Top Off. *
  • Project and thought leadership through meaningful assignments.
  • Assigned mentors who provide advice and guidance throughout the program to support career growth and personal development.
  • Ongoing engagement and strong support from program leadership and cohort
  • RDP Associates are required to obtain their Securities Industry Essentials (SIE), Series 7 Top-Off within the first twelve weeks of their start date.

Edward Jones' compensation and benefits package includes medical and prescription drug, dental, vision, voluntary benefits (such as accident, hospital indemnity, and critical illness), short- and long-term disability, basic life, and basic AD&D coverage. Short- and long-term disability, basic life, and basic AD&D coverage are provided at no cost to associates. Edward Jones offers a 401k retirement plan, and tax-advantaged accounts: health savings account, and flexible spending account. Edward Jones observes ten paid holidays and provides 15 days of vacation for new associates beginning on January 1 of each year, as well as sick time, personal days, and a paid day for volunteerism. Associates may be eligible for bonuses and profit sharing. All associates are eligible for the firm's Employee Assistance Program. For more information on the Benefits available to Edward Jones associates, please visit our benefits page ( .

Hiring Minimum: $46600

Hiring Maximum: $76800
